Output 16a31ec66517b762a0e8fc2eb212a9845b2686eadba93cf49c6f3e4e27f4ab9f:6

value
53850
script pubkey
OP_0 OP_PUSHBYTES_20 2d642e2fdbb3c036ae4db32b626c9767d0f7672a
address
bc1q94jzut7mk0qrdtjdkv4kymyhvlg0wee2jrjk7c
transaction
16a31ec66517b762a0e8fc2eb212a9845b2686eadba93cf49c6f3e4e27f4ab9f
confirmations
203
spent
true